For this week's sync: in Hollowpine v4.2, FANOUT_MAX_PENDING is renamed FANOUT_BACKPRESSURE_LIMIT. Old name is ignored silently — no warning — so stale env files will run with the default of 500 and notification workers will shed load earlier than expected. Update every deployment env file before rolling v4.2. While editing, note that the backpressure reporter now also requires its metrics-push credential in the same file; the old keystore path is gone. Append that credential line immediately after the renamed setting.

sealed setting: RELAY_SECRET5=82864

**Vendor note: Inkmill markdown pipeline**

Rendering for Parchway docs is outsourced to Inkmill under an annual contract, renewing each March. They handle sanitization and PDF export; we own the upload queue. SLA: 4-hour response on rendering failures. Escalate only after two failed retries. Their support desk is reachable at the address below.

billing contact of hahaf-baguf = zorael.tammir.jorius@sivrelhq.internal

Ticket #4471 — Vault locked, contrast audit artifacts inaccessible

The Lumenward vault holding the color-contrast accessibility audit results for the Oakspire dashboard auto-locked after three failed unlock attempts by the audit bot. Support needs read access to share the WCAG findings with the design team before Thursday's review. The vault admin has rotated the unlock credential; the current recovery passphrase is provided below for reference.

unlock words, hahip-baduf: holwyn-istath-julvan

# Billing Worker: Environments

Tallyforge billing worker runs blue-green. Two stacks: cobalt and jade. Only one takes queue traffic; cutover flips the consumer group pointer. Drain timeout 90s. Rollback = flip back, no redeploy. Migrations run before flip, never after. Known gap: jade lags one minor version of the ledger client; fix tracked for next sync. Active stack settings for this week are as follows.

deployment values, bahof-badug:
[rusix]
team = zorok
access_code = ac_641cbe
owner = ulair.tamius
host = rusix.torvasoft.local
port = 5672
peer = ulaix.sivrelworks.internal
salt = 1df570ed
pin = 6327